The Importance of Core Strength and Body Awareness in Pilates Barre
Core strength and body awareness are essential components of a successful Pilates Barre practice. Pilates Barre combines the principles of Pilates with elements of ballet and dance to create a dynamic and effective workout that focuses on improving strength, flexibility, and posture.
Why Core Strength Matters
Core strength refers to the muscles in the abdomen, pelvis, lower back, and hips. A strong core is vital for overall stability and balance in the body. In Pilates Barre, core strength is emphasized through exercises that target the deep abdominal muscles, helping to improve posture, reduce the risk of injury, and enhance athletic performance.

The Role of Body Awareness
Body awareness involves understanding how your body moves and functions in space. In Pilates Barre, body awareness is developed through precise movements and alignment cues. By focusing on alignment and breath control, practitioners can improve their mind-body connection and enhance their overall movement quality.
